6 Take care not to connect too many equipment to the same mains socket as it may cause overloading resulting in fi re or electric shock. 7 Avoid placing a vase or vases fi lled with water on top or near the TV. Water spilled into the set could result in electric shock. Do not operate set if water is spilled into the set. SETUP : to display or exit menus. 1 2 1 2 : to change value when a certain menu is selected. 3 TV/AV : to switch to AV mode or to resume TV mode 4 3 4 CH : to move cursor up/down to select menu items. 5 POWER : to switch the TV on and off. (Note: For ON/OFF zero power consumption, you need to remove the mains cord from the mains socket.) 6 VOLUME : to increase or decrease the volume. 7 ; : Headphone jack. 8 AV IN : Audio/Video input. 9 DC IN : Power supply socket. Symptom Remedy Player feels warm • When the player is in use for a long period of time, the surface will be heated. This is normal.
